
Overview
The Cognitive Science course from University of Malta will run over three semesters. During the first week of the first semester a series of Cognitive Science Overview seminars will be held to introduce you to Cognitive Science and serve as a foundation for subsequent topics. The course will then follow a Semester-by-Semester plan. The first semester will use a traditional, parallel study-units structure to provide a comprehensive introduction to theory and practical methods across a range of Cognitive Science topics. The second semester will use a series of “block” study-units to provide more focused and detailed exposure to specific areas of research in which you are exposed to the latest trends in this highly active area. The third semester will allow you to apply knowledge by embarking on empirical or theoretical work in the form of a Dissertation.
Career opportunites and access to further studies
By arming participants with an exciting and possibly unique mix of knowledge and skills, the M.Sc. in Cognitive Science provides an excellent foundation for any career involving the brain, human cognition and behaviour.
These may include: cognitive psychology, rehabilitation, education, communications, human-computer interaction, information processing, data retrieval, medical analysis, consumer behavior and neuromarketing.Training in cognitive science also provides a broad educational base from which to pursue further academic study.

Other requirements
General requirements
- The Course shall be open to applicants in possession of a Bachelor's degree from this University, or from any other university approved by Senate for this purpose, obtained with at least Second Class Honours or Category II.
- All applicants shall be required to submit with their application a letter giving their motivation for applying for this Course, and shall further be required to attend for an interview to assess their suitability to follow the Course with profit.
